Neapolitan Pound Cake

Ingredients

  • 3 oz cream cheese, at room temperature
  • 5 oz mascarpone cheese, at room temperature
  • 1 ½ cups unsalted butter, at room temperature
  • 3 tsp vanilla extract, divided
  • 6 large eggs
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 3 cups cake flour
  • Pinch of salt
  • 6 TBSP strawberry jam
  • 3 TBSP un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 4-5 drops neon pink food coloring

Preparing Your Neapolitan Pound Cake

Neapolitan Pound Cake

Prepare the Loaf Pan

Start by spraying a 16-x-4-x-4 ½ inch loaf pan with baking spray. This ensures your cake comes out easily. Set it aside for now; no need to preheat the oven just yet.

Cream the Cheeses and Butter

Next, grab your stand mixer with a paddle attachment or use a hand mixer. Beat together the cream cheese, mascarpone cheese, and unsalted butter on medium-high speed until it’s creamy. This will be the base for your delicious cake.

Add Vanilla and Eggs

Once creamy, it’s time to incorporate some flavor. Add 2 teaspoons of vanilla extract and blend for another 30 seconds. Gradually add two eggs while you mix.

Combine the Sugars

In a separate medium bowl, sift together the granulated sugar and powdered sugar until they’re thoroughly combined. This step is essential for a smooth batter.

Incorporate Sugar Mixture

While your mixer is still running, slowly add 1 cup of the sugar mixture. Keep mixing until everything is well combined and fluffy.

Add Flour and Salt

Now, introduce 1 cup of cake flour and a pinch of salt to the mix. Blend until fully incorporated. This will give your cake that lovely, tender crumb.

Repeat Mixing Process

You will continue this process: add eggs, the remaining sugar mixture, and cake flour in alternating batches until all ingredients are mixed well. It’s all about building that perfect batter.

Color and Flavor the Batter

Once your batter is ready, divide it evenly into three bowls.

Mix Strawberry Batter

In one bowl, add the 6 tablespoons of strawberry jam and the drops of neon pink food coloring. Mix until everything is fully combined.

Mix Chocolate Batter

In the second bowl, add the 3 tablespoons of unsweetened cocoa powder. Blend it in until the color and flavor are consistent throughout.

Final Vanilla Batter

For the last bowl, add the remaining 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ract to the vanilla batter. Mix it all together until it’s well combined.

Fill Piping Bags

Now, you can use three disposable piping bags. Fill each one with the respective batter: vanilla, strawberry, and chocolate. If you don’t have piping bags, a spoon works just fine!

Layer the Batters

Here comes the fun part! Carefully pipe a bit of vanilla batter into the prepared loaf pan, followed by a layer of strawberry, then chocolate. Repeat this process until all of the batter is used up.

Swirl the Batters

With a butter knife or a wooden skewer, gently swirl the batters together. This creates a beautiful marbled effect that will surprise your guests when they see the slices.

Bake the Cake

Place your loaf pan in the oven. Now, turn your oven on to 295°F and bake for approximately 2 hours. Keep an eye on it, and when a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, it’s done!

Serving Suggestions

When it’s time to enjoy your Neapolitan Pound Cake, dust it with powdered sugar or add a dollop of whipped cream. Fresh strawberries or chocolate shavings on top can elevate its charm and make it a showstopper for any gathering.

Tips for Success

  • Make sure all dairy ingredients are at room temperature. They’ll blend better, giving you that desired smooth batter.
  • Don’t skip the swirling! It’s crucial for achieving that gorgeous marbled look.
  • Keep an eye on the cake as baking times can vary based on your oven.

Variations

Feel like getting creative? Swap out the flavors! Try adding lemon zest for a fresh twist, or substitute the strawberry jam with raspberry for a different fruity delight.

Storage Tips

Store your Neapolitan Pound C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and freeze for up to a month.

Pairing Ideas

This cake pairs wonderfully with coffee, a glass of milk, or even a scoop of vanilla ice cream. It can elevate your dessert experience to something truly special.

Neapolitan Pound Cake

FAQs

1. Can I use different types of flour?
Yes! While cake flour gives a light texture, all-purpose flour can work too.

2. How do I make this cake gluten-free?
You can substitute the cake flour with a gluten-free flour blend for a delicious alternative.

3. How long will this cake last after baking?
The Neapolitan Pound Cake stays fresh for about 3 days at room temperature. If frozen, it can last for a month.

4. Can I add fruits to the batter?
Absolutely! You can fold in fresh strawberries or chocolate chips to enhance flavors.

5. What’s the best way to thaw a frozen cake?
To thaw, place it in the refrigerator overnight, then bring it to room temperature before serving.
